Output 873d34dea59e603354623d6fe3ff76d4acd4d10e3b35839bfc2f4350cd282956:44

value
239284228800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31f8956127f841846373b4d533b0bf10c59399d9 OP_EQUAL
address
36FEpq2FdvHNXyPZdeDmFMCA2NaY4ZDATu
transaction
873d34dea59e603354623d6fe3ff76d4acd4d10e3b35839bfc2f4350cd282956
spent
true